I could spend A LOT of time talking about my issues with this film. 😉
Aside from the points that get brought up a lot, one thing I would look at is playing around with the pacing of scenes on Endor. You can play up the fact that Leia is missing for a bit (after the chase). Cut down certain shots to remove goofy expressions. Change the music to insert some tension. This was something I made a long time ago but I still like the ideas behind some of the changes I made (even if most of them are poorly executed…or I would continue to developed further):

https://streamable.com/zve2u9

  • Han stepping on a twig, thus alerting the trooper to his presence, was incredibly lazy storytelling. I like my change to the scene, but it was mostly for fun. I feel like something else should trigger the troopers instead.
  • Adding as much believability to our main heroes’ actions is a must.
  • Playing around with the Leia and Wicket scenes helps address why she just pops up in the Ewok village out of nowhere.
  • Generally, I liked what I did to the Han/Luke “Where’s Leia?” scene. It adds more tension and just…it heightens everything a bit more to where one might sit up and pay more attention.
  • Just cutting down the humor…or at least allowing it to happen at more strategic times will help quite a bit.
